Georgia Power Company hereby provides the following information in response to the violation cited in NRC I&E Report 50-321/84-32 and 50-366/84-32 dated Septaber 17, 1984. The subject violation was identified during the NRC inspection conducted at-Plant Hatch Units 1 and 2 by Mr.
P. M. Madden of your staff on August 21-24, 1984.
VIOIATICN Technical Specification, Section 6.8.1.f requires written procedures to be established, impleented and maintained covering the fire protection progra impl e entation.
Procedure HNP-1-3372-E, Rev.
O, Fire Protection Hydrant House Inspection, Section G. - 60 Day Inspection, requires that two 50 ft. sections of 2-1/2" hose corw:ted together, be arranged in an accordion fold on the lower shelf, and that equipnent found to be defective or in need of repair be replaced or repaired prior to cmpletion of the inspection.
Contrary to the above, on August 23, 1984, the hoses inside hydrant houses 2 and 4 were not arranged in accordance with the procedure and in hydrant house 2, a hydrant wrench was found with a severely bent handle and another one with a handle broken off.
This is a Severity Level V violation (Suppleent I).

RESPONSE
' Admission or denial of alleged violation: 2 e violation occurred.-
Reason for the violation: Personnel violated the surveillance requirenents by failing to. follow specific steps of the' Plant Hatch fire protection procedure (IEP-1-3372-E, Rev. 0) which require correction of deficiencies y
prior to the conclusion of the surveillance.
Corrective' steps which have been taken and the results achieved:
Dunediate action was taken.to correct all deficiencies.
Se 2-1/2" fire-hore was
_ arranged in an accordion fold and connected to the hydrant, wx1 the <'anaged i
hydrant wrenches were replaced.
l
~
corrective stem which will be taken to avoid future violations:
Personnel performing th:.s. procedure have been counseled on the requirenents of procedure compliance. Disciplinary action has been initiated.
In addition,.
increased' managenent supervision is being' utilized in the fire protection surveillance procrat.
Date when full compliance will be achieved; Full' cappliance was achieved on August 24, 1984 when the inspection deficiencies were corrected.
